Tropical Depression IDA Public Advisory Number 33

2015-09-26 16:35:55| National Hurricane Center (Atlantic)

Issued at 1100 AM AST SAT SEP 26 2015 000 WTNT35 KNHC 261435 TCPAT5 BULLETIN TROPICAL DEPRESSION IDA ADVISORY NUMBER 33 NWS NATIONAL HURRICANE CENTER MIAMI FL AL102015 1100 AM AST SAT SEP 26 2015 ...IDA STILL A TROPICAL DEPRESSION OVER THE CENTRAL ATLANTIC... SUMMARY OF 1100 AM AST...1500 UTC...INFORMATION ----------------------------------------------- LOCATION...24.0N 46.5W ABOUT 1140 MI...1835 KM ENE OF THE NORTHERN LEEWARD ISLANDS MAXIMUM SUSTAINED WINDS...35 MPH...55 KM/H PRESENT MOVEMENT...NNW OR 330 DEGREES AT 8 MPH...13 KM/H MINIMUM CENTRAL PRESSURE...1006 MB...29.71 INCHES WATCHES AND WARNINGS -------------------- There are no coastal watches or warnings in effect. DISCUSSION AND 48-HOUR OUTLOOK ------------------------------ At 1100 AM AST (1500 UTC), the center of Tropical Depression Ida was located near latitude 24.0 North, longitude 46.5 West. The depression is moving toward the north-northwest near 8 mph. A turn toward the west and then southwest is forecast during the next day or two. Maximum sustained winds remain near 35 mph (55 km/h) with higher gusts. Little change in strength is forecast during the next 48 hours. The estimated minimum central pressure is 1006 mb (29.71 inches). HAZARDS AFFECTING LAND ---------------------- None. NEXT ADVISORY ------------- Next complete advisory at 500 PM AST. $$ Forecaster Cangialosi
